Rounding the Thomas Point Light by Edward W. Edder

Rounding the Thomas Point Light
Edward W. Edder

Intarsia, depicting a working skipjack sailing by the Thomas Point Shoals Lighthouse in the Chesapeake Bay. This piece contains 341 pieces of the Wye Oak, each taken from a single board.

Dimensions: 18 3/8” High, 22 18” Wide

About the Artist: Mr. Edder has been working with wood as a hobbyist for more than 20 years. He became interested in intarsia eight years ago and has completed approximately 25 pieces of varying degrees of difficulty. “Rounding the Thomas Point Light” is his first original design, with more than 425 hours to completion.
